Navajo Shoe Game Sammie Largo

The first Shoe Game was played in the month of December. The Day team had four moccasins placed on the south side of the hogan. All of its team members were female. Talking God furnished the blanket for concealing where the yucca ball was placed by the Day team, but he just watched the game. not wanting to interfere. Members of the Day team included jackrabbit, porcupine. bird people, antelope, locust, horses, sheep. gopher and one earth-surface person.The Night team placed its four moccasins on the north side of the hogan. All of its team members were male. The Bat furnished the blanket used to hide the moccasins from the view of the Day team members. Among the members of the Night team were bear, lion. owl. fox, wolf, bobcat, giant, snake, turkey and firefly.Antelope came forward to drop a corn husk to determine which team started the game. The Night team won and went first. Bear hid the ball for the Night team and porcupine held the stick first for the Day team. The same person from each team continued to hide the yucca ball in the toe of one of the moccasins. Someone from the opposing team then guessed where the ball was hidden by hitting a moccasin with a stick. Team members worked together to determine where they thought the ball was hidden while the other team did its best to distract them with songs and teasing. The songs sometimes criticized the personalities of animals hiding the ball in order to keep interest in the game high.
